2= Your component outputs may be labeled Y, B-Y, and R-Y= In this case, connect the components
B-Y output to the TV's PB input and
the components
R-Y output to the TV's PR input.
3. Your component
outputs may be labeled Y-CBCR.
In this case, connect the component
C B output to the TV's PB input and the
component
C R output to the TV's PR input.
4. It may be necessary to adjust TINT to obtain optimum picture quality when using the Y-PBPR inputs. (See page 35)
5. To ensure no copyright infringement,
the MONITOR OUT output will be abnormal, when using the Y-PBPR jacks.

DVI-HDTV input (Input 1)
Use this DVI-HDTV input for your external devices with DVI-HDTV output such as a Set-Top-Box, high-band
DTV decoders, DVD
players and D-VHS with Digital Content Protection.
NOTES:
1. Only DTV format such as 1080i, 720p, 480i and 480p are available for DVFHDTV input.
2. The DVI-HDTV input is NOT compatible when used with a DVD player from a personal computer.
3. When connecting a Set-Top-Box with a copy-protect digital out termina!, a high definition picture can be displayed
on the screen in its digital form.
